在当今这个快速发展的数字时代,区块链技术正逐渐走进我们的生活,并在众多行业中激起波澜。作为一种去中心化的分布式账本技术,区块链不仅改变了金融行业的格局,还在供应链管理、医疗、房地产等多个领域展现出广泛的应用前景。本文将详细解析区块链平台的相关知识,以助于读者更好地理解这一技术的潜力与未来发展。
区块链平台是指基于区块链技术构建的一种开发环境,为开发者提供了一系列工具和服务,以便他们可以在此基础上创建和管理分布式应用(DApps)。区块链平台的核心特点包括去中心化、安全性、透明性和不可篡改性,这使得它们在数据管理和交易记录方面具有广泛应用的潜力。
区块链平台的工作原理可以简单总结为:在每一次交易发生时,交易信息会被打包成一个“区块”,然后通过网络传输给其他节点进行验证,一旦验证通过,这个区块就会被添加到现有的链条上。整个过程依赖于密码学和共识机制,确保了每一次交易的安全性和透明度。
根据不同的应用需求和技术特点,区块链平台主要可以分为公有链、私有链和联盟链。
公有链:像比特币、以太坊这样的公有链,任何人都可以参与到网络中来进行交易和验证。这种开放性和匿名性使得公有链在某种程度上更具分散性和透明性,适合应用在需要高度信任和开放的场合。
私有链:私有链则是相对封闭的网络,仅限于特定企业或组织内部使用。私有链在安全性和效率上通常优于公有链,但在去中心化程度上有所降低,适合企业内部数据管理和操作。
联盟链:联盟链介于公有链和私有链之间,由多个组织共同维护,可以提高安全性和效率,同时又保持了一定的开放性。供应链管理、金融结算等领域常常采用联盟链技术。
区块链平台的重要性源于其能够为传统行业和现代科技带来颠覆性改变。首先,区块链以其去中心化的特性减少了对中介的依赖,有效降低了交易成本和时间,提升了效率。其次,区块链提供了更高的安全保障,通过加密算法和共识机制,极大降低了数据篡改的风险。
此外,区块链作为一种透明的记录保存方式,能够提升各方的信任感。对于监管机构来说,透明的交易记录也便于合规与审计,可谓一举多得。因此,越来越多的行业开始探索并应用区块链技术,以推动创新和发展。
区块链技术在各行各业都有其独特的应用案例,以下是几个值得一提的例子:
金融行业:区块链在金融领域的应用尤为广泛,主要通过加密货币、跨境支付、智能合约等方式重塑传统金融产品。例如,Ripple协议所提供的跨境支付解决方案,利用区块链技术实现实时资金转移,减少了传统银行系统中高昂的手续费和较长的处理时间。
供应链管理:在供应链管理中,区块链可以建立每一个环节的透明记录。例如,沃尔玛使用区块链技术追踪产品的来源,从农田到超市货架,让消费者了解所购买商品的真实信息以增强信任。
医疗行业:在医疗行业,区块链技术可以用于安全存储患者的健康记录,确保只有经过授权的医疗机构能够访问这些信息。这不仅保护了患者的隐私,还提高了数据的互操作性,从而显著提升医疗服务的效率和质量。
房地产:在房地产交易中,区块链可用于简化和自动化繁琐的交易过程。例如,智能合约可以在完成交易前自动验证所有条件的达成,确保双方权益,从而减少交易中的法律风险以及时间成本。
这些案例展示了区块链技术在提升效率、减少信任成本及保障数据安全等方面的巨大潜力,未来还会有更多行业参与到这场技术革命中来。
在选择合适的区块链平台时,需要考虑多个因素:
需求分析:首先,明确你的业务需求至关重要。不同类型的区块链平台适用于不同的用例。例如,如果你需要在开放的环境中运作,公有链可能是一个好选择;如果是企业内部应用,私有链更适合。
技术支持:不同区块链平台的开发环境和工具支持也不尽相同。选择一个拥有良好文档、活跃社区、以及强大技术支持的区块链平台,会使开发过程更加顺利。
安全性:安全性是选择区块链平台时不可忽视的因素。确保所选平台具有先进的加密机制和安全协议,有助于防范潜在的安全威胁。
扩展性:随着业务的发展,可能需要对现有的区块链解决方案进行拓展和升级。所以在选择平台时要考虑到其扩展性,确保能够适应未来的需求变化。
成本效益:最后,必要的成本评估不能忽视。了解不同平台之间的费用结构,选择一个具有良好成本效益的解决方案,有助于控制投资风险。
区块链和传统数据库的区别可以从多个方面进行比较。首先,在架构上,传统数据库是集中式的结构,由单一实体控制数据存储和管理。而区块链则是去中心化的,数据在多个节点之间共享,任何人都可以访问。
其次,在数据透明性方面,区块链提供了公开的历史记录,任何人都可以查看交易的全过程,而传统数据库通常只对数据库管理员可见,缺乏透明度。
再者,传统数据库在数据更新和删除方面相对容易,数据可以在任何时间被修改或删除;而在区块链上,一旦数据被记录就无法篡改或删除,这使得区块链的数据更为可靠。
最后,安全性也是两者的显著区别。传统数据库面临着中心化攻击的风险,而区块链运用密码学和共识机制,极大地提高了安全性保障。
区块链的设计初衷之一是解决信任问题。在传统的商业环境中,各方通常需要依赖中介来构建信任,因为直接交易可能存在信息不对称和道德风险。而区块链通过提供透明、公开和可验证的交易记录,消除了这种对中介的需求。
通过去中心化的方式,所有参与者都有权访问相同的信息,确保交易过程公开透明。同时,区块链的不可篡改性确保了记录的真实性,使得信任不再是基于人或机构,而是基于技术本身。
不过,尽管区块链能解决很多信任问题,但其有效性也依赖于参与者的合规行为。例如,用户在链上提供虚假信息仍然会影响整体信任度。因此,区块链并非万能,合规和自律仍是关键。
区块链的未来发展趋势将受到技术进步和市场需求的双重影响。一方面,随着技术的不断迭代升级,诸如以太坊2.0、Polkadot等新一代区块链将会使得跨链交互、交易速度和安全性得到进一步提升。
另一方面,越来越多的行业开始关注区块链的应用潜力,从金融、供应链到医疗、政府服务等,各行业将逐步探索和实现区块链技术的融合与创新。
此外,随着数字货币和资产的逐渐普及,各国政府及各大金融机构也会加强对区块链的监管与政策制定,这将直接影响区块链的合法性和合规性,促使企业采用更可靠的区块链解决方案。
总体而言,未来区块链的市场将越来越成熟,同时也将迎来适用于商业场景的更多技术创新和应用案例。
参与区块链项目的开发,首先需要学习和掌握区块链相关的技术基础,如理解工作原理、技术架构和基本编程语言(如Solidity、JavaScript等)。现在许多在线课程和教育平台提供了免费的或者付费的区块链基础课程,非常适合新手入门。
其次,了解各种区块链平台的特点和生态系统是必要的,例如以太坊、Hyperledger、EOS等,每个平台都有其独特的优势和适用场景。选择一到两个平台深入学习,有助于提升技术能力。
若有编程背景,可以通过参与开源项目来积累经验和建立人脉。这些开源项目提供了丰富的实践机会,可以通过GitHub等平台寻找合适的项目,积极参与讨论和贡献代码。
最后,保持对区块链领域的关注和热爱,跟随最新的技术更新和市场动态,有助于在快速发展的区块链行业中站稳脚跟。
区块链在社会中的影响力逐渐显现,特别是在涉及安全、透明和效率等方面。其去中心化的机制能够解决传统系统中的信任和透明性问题,从而推动社会各领域的进步。
在金融服务领域,区块链使得高成本的中介和冗余步骤被精简,大幅提高了交易效率和成本效益。同时,区块链技术还能够为金融普惠事业提供保障,使得更多人享受到金融服务。
在政治和社会治理上,区块链的透明性能够改善政府信任度,提升公民参与感。例如,利用区块链技术进行电子投票,可以确保投票过程的透明和安全,减少舞弊的可能性。
此外,区块链在公益事业和慈善组织中的应用,能够追踪款项流向,确保捐款的使用透明有效,这有助于提升人们对慈善项目的信任度。
然而,区块链也面的挑战,如技术普及的速度、政策法规的滞后等,这都需要时间来逐渐完善。总的来说,区块链在社会中的影响力是积极的,随着其应用的逐渐普及,将会在未来引领更多行业的变革。
综上所述,区块链平台作为现代技术革新的产物,将继续在众多领域发挥作用。理解和掌握这一技术,对于任何希望在未来数字经济中立足的人来说,都是一项重要的技能和知识。